Output d823c8264f3de99c1427f7292fb726ee6b3885a43f5b5fca115438641e11f5f3:0

value
653193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908762404603f32d66c1ecfe4e087db3a96941eb OP_EQUAL
address
3EsDQoFPaji9fx2Xh2Tj4bxYJvEo1GQfXP
transaction
d823c8264f3de99c1427f7292fb726ee6b3885a43f5b5fca115438641e11f5f3
spent
true